public TfsLegacyCoverageReportProcessor(ICoverageUrlProvider urlProvider, ICoverageReportDownloader downloader, ICoverageReportConverter converter, ILogger logger) // was internal : base(converter, logger) { this.urlProvider = urlProvider ?? throw new ArgumentNullException(nameof(urlProvider)); this.downloader = downloader ?? throw new ArgumentNullException(nameof(downloader)); }
public TfsLegacyCoverageReportProcessor(ICoverageUrlProvider urlProvider, ICoverageReportDownloader downloader, ICoverageReportConverter converter) // was internal : base(converter) { if (urlProvider == null) { throw new ArgumentNullException("urlProvider"); } if (downloader == null) { throw new ArgumentNullException("downloader"); } this.urlProvider = urlProvider; this.downloader = downloader; }